Aggarwal made her cinematic debut with a minor role in the Hindi film Kyun! Ho Gaya Na... (2004), but her trajectory changed significantly when she entered the Telugu industry. Her major breakthrough came with S.S. Rajamouli’s historical epic , where her dual role as Yuvarani Mitravinda earned her critical acclaim and her first Filmfare nomination.
